AFROPUNK Rock ‘n’ Read Book Club Presents Ashley Woodfolk with RH’s Porscha Burke via Instagram Live (7/15)

Penguin Random House’s partnership with AFROPUNK includes a 10-week Rock ‘n’ Read Book Club Instagram Live interview series hosted by AFROPUNK, exploring topics around storytelling, identity and the creative process with Penguin Random House authors.

Ashley Woodfolk (@ashwrites), author of WHEN YOU WERE EVERYTHING (Delacorte Press), will be in conversation with

Porscha Burke, Senior Editor, Publishing Manager, Convergent, Random House, via Instagram Live on Wednesday, July 15, at 5:00 pm (ET). The event bookstore partner is Eso Won (@esowonbooiks).

WHEN YOU WERE EVERYTHING is a heartfelt and ultimately uplifting novel follows one sixteen-year-old girl’s friend breakup through two concurrent timelines–ultimately proving that even endings can lead to new beginnings.
